Understanding Blackjack Rules
Blackjack is simple: the goal is to have a hand value closer to 21 than the dealer’s without going over. Players are dealt two cards, typically one face-up and one face-down for the dealer. Cards 2 through 10 are worth their face value, while face cards (Jacks, Queens, Kings) are worth 10, and Aces can be 1 or 11.
- Players can choose to hit (take another card) or stand (keep their current hand).
- If a player exceeds 21, they bust and lose the round.
- Blackjack (an Ace and a 10-value card) pays 3:2, while other wins typically pay 1:1.
Strategies for Winning
Employing a solid strategy can enhance your chances of winning. One effective method is the basic strategy chart, which outlines optimal moves based on your hand and the dealer’s visible card.
- Always hit if your total is 11 or less.
- Stand on 17 or higher.
- Double down on 10 or 11 when the dealer shows a lower card (2-9).
In my testing, I found that using basic strategy can reduce the house edge significantly—often down to around 0.5%. This can make a substantial difference over time.
